Core Insights - The 138th China Import and Export Fair showcased Haier's AI-driven washing machine, which became a focal point for attendees and attracted international buyers [1] - The Haier three-tub washing machine has demonstrated strong market performance, with nearly 200,000 units delivered since its launch in April, and close to one million orders received at the IFA exhibition in September [1][2] - The product's design and functionality are centered around user needs, featuring a unique three-tub design that allows for efficient washing of different clothing types simultaneously, saving approximately 50% of washing time [1] Product Innovation - Haier's product innovation is rooted in localized research and development, integrating resources from ten global R&D centers to meet diverse user demands [2] - The three-tub washing machine's development involved collaboration with over 100 external partners to enhance product functionality [2] - Previous models, such as the Haier X11 washing machine, have also achieved significant market success and international recognition, further establishing Haier's presence in high-end markets [2] Global Expansion - The three-tub washing machine is set to enter European and Middle Eastern markets, reinforcing Haier's global strategy [2] - Differentiated innovative products like the three-tub and X11 washing machines are expected to enhance user experience and solidify Haier's leading position in the global market [2]

Core Insights - The rise of consumer awareness regarding garment health management is driving the trend of segmented washing in the home appliance market [1] - Haier's three-tub washing machine has rapidly gained popularity in the domestic market and is set to launch in Europe after successful entry into Southeast Asia [1] Group 1: Product Innovation - Haier's three-tub washing machine features a unique design with a 10kg large tub and two 1kg small tubs, allowing for precise segmentation of laundry, which can save approximately 50% of washing time [1] - The product incorporates advanced technologies such as UV sterilization and 95°C high-temperature washing, providing specialized disinfection for different types of garments [1] - AI technology is integrated into the washing machine for intelligent detergent dispensing, enhancing the user experience [1] Group 2: Market Performance - At the IFA in Germany, Haier's three-tub washing machine attracted significant attention, resulting in over one million orders during the event [1] - The product has achieved over 72 million online exposures in Europe, setting historical records for viewership across multiple media platforms [1] - Haier's washing machine industry leads in sales and revenue among Chinese companies in Europe, with top market positions in various countries including the UK, Italy, Spain, and France [2]

Group 1: Event Overview - The 2025 Berlin International Consumer Electronics Show was held from September 5 to 9, featuring over 1,900 exhibitors and focusing on themes of innovation, sustainability, and digital transformation [1] - More than 690 Chinese companies participated, accounting for over one-third of the exhibitors, with notable attention on innovations from Haier, TCL, and Hisense [1] Group 2: Artificial Intelligence in Home Appliances - AI technology was prominently featured, with products like service robots and smart vacuum cleaners enhancing home living experiences [2] - Bosch showcased a fully embedded robotic vacuum that integrates with water and power supplies for automated cleaning [2] - Siemens introduced an AI oven capable of independently recognizing and cooking up to 100 different dishes [2] Group 3: Sustainability and Smart Home Design - Sustainable development principles were integrated into smart home designs, exemplified by Grover's mini hydroponic farm that allows for easy vegetable cultivation [3] - Haier presented its "AI Eye" technology, which optimizes food storage conditions and energy efficiency in appliances [3] Group 4: Innovations from Chinese Companies - TCL's AI companion robot, AiMe, demonstrated advanced interaction capabilities and integration with home devices [4] - Lenovo launched innovative products including a vertically rotating laptop screen and AI-driven solutions for enhanced user experience [4] - Hisense showcased advancements in display technology with a 116-inch RGB-Mini LED TV [5] Group 5: Market Trends and Collaborations - The global home appliance and consumer electronics market reached $403 billion in sales in the first half of 2025, with a 4.6% year-on-year growth, driven by emerging markets [7] - Chinese home appliance companies are increasingly recognized as significant players in the global market, with a focus on quality and cost-effectiveness [7] - Collaborations between Chinese companies and international partners are enhancing technological integration and market presence [7] Group 6: Sports Marketing and Brand Culture - Chinese companies are leveraging sports events for brand promotion, with TCL and Haier forming partnerships with major football clubs and Hisense becoming a global sponsor for the 2026 World Cup [8]

Group 1: ESG Performance - The company implements a "6-Green" strategy, creating a complete green chain from product design to recycling [1]. - Haier has launched numerous energy-efficient products globally, such as the award-winning Mailang refrigerator, which consumes less than one kilowatt-hour per day and sold 400,000 units within two quarters [1]. - The Leader washing machine, popular among young consumers, achieved sales of over 20,000 units within 16 hours of its launch [1]. - In Europe, the Haier X11 washing machine is 60% more energy-efficient than the European A-grade standard [1]. - Haier air conditioners in Southeast Asia utilize AI to optimize energy consumption, providing users with visualized energy usage [1]. Group 2: Recycling Initiatives - Haier has established the industry's first recycling interconnected factory, achieving over 95% resource utilization from disassembled electronic waste [3]. - The company has expanded its old appliance recycling network globally, including regions like New Zealand, the UK, France, Italy, and Singapore [3]. - Haier Europe has joined the EU WEEE Recycling Alliance, while GE Appliances collaborates with the U.S. EPA to reduce carbon emissions [3]. Group 3: Social Responsibility - Haier has built over 400 Hope Schools in China, making it the leading enterprise in the Central Youth League's Hope Project [3]. - The company extends its care globally through donations, internships, and sports activities, fostering social value [3]. - Haier adheres to principles of "integrity management, standardized governance, and information transparency" to ensure sustainable development [3].
